Description A multi-model database supporting graphs, key-value pairs, and documents in a unified JSON-based data model. Offers both an in-memory storage engine and a RocksDB-based engine for larger datasets.A discontinued IBM Research graph platform supporting both property graph and RDF models. Used compressed sparse vector storage with temporal offsets and included visual query tools.
